Abstract
OBJECTIVE: To compare community involvement of pediatricians exposed to enhanced residency training as part of the Dyson Community Pediatrics Training Initiative (CPTI) with involvement reported by a national sample of pediatricians. METHODS: A cross-sectional analyses compared 2008-2010 mailed surveys of CPTI graduates 5 years after residency graduation with comparably aged respondents in a 2010 mailed national American Academy of Pediatrics survey of US pediatricians (CPTI: n = 234, response = 56.0%; national sample: n = 243; response = 59.9%). Respondents reported demographic characteristics, practice characteristics (setting, time spent in general pediatrics), involvement in community child health activities in past 12 months, use of ≥1 strategies to influence community child health (eg, educate legislators), and being moderately/very versus not at all/minimally skilled in 6 such activities (eg, identify community needs). χ(2) statistics assessed differences between groups; logistic regression modeled the independent association of CPTI with community involvement adjusting for personal and practice characteristics and perspectives regarding involvement. RESULTS: Compared with the national sample, more CPTI graduates reported involvement in community pediatrics (43.6% vs 31.1%, P < .01) and being moderately/very skilled in 4 of 6 community activities (P < .05). Comparable percentages used ≥1 strategies (52.2% vs 47.3%, P > .05). Differences in involvement remained in adjusted analyses with greater involvement by CPTI graduates (adjusted odds ratio 2.4, 95% confidence interval 1.5-3.7). CONCLUSIONS: Five years after residency, compared with their peers, more CPTI graduates report having skills and greater community pediatrics involvement. Enhanced residency training in community pediatrics may lead to a more engaged pediatrician workforce.
